FOUR NON-FICTION WRITERS!
Peg Guilfoyle is the author of The Guthrie Theater: Images, History, and Inside Stories (Nodin Press), which won a Midwest Book Award and an Independent Publishers Award, and Offstage Voices: Life in Twin Cities Theater (Minnesota Historical Society Press). Her commentary and essays have appeared in the Minneapolis Star Tribune, the Minnesota Women’s Press, the St. Paul Pioneer Press, on Minnesota Public Radio, and elsewhere. Peg's latest book is An Eye For Joy: Noticing The Good World Everywhere, published in November by Sea Crow Press, and she is the author of Motley Peg, a series of short essays with 800 subscribers
Patrick Hicks is the author of fifteen books, including The Collector of Names, This London, Adoptable, In the Shadow of Dora, and Across the Lake—he also wrote the critically and popularly acclaimed novel, The Commandant of Lubizec. His work has appeared on NPR, The PBS Newshour, American Life in Poetry. After living in Europe for many years, he now lives in the Midwest where he is the Writer-in-Residence at Augustana University as well as a faculty member in the MFA program at the University of Nevada Reno at Lake Tahoe. His latest book is Greater Minnesota.
Laurie Hertzel is the former long-time books editor at the Minnesota Star Tribune and the author of two memoirs, News to Me: Adventures of an Accidental Journalist, winner of a Minnesota Book Award, and Ghosts of Fourth Street: My Family, a Death, and the Hills of Duluth, newly published by the University of Minnesota Press. Her book reviews have appeared in the Boston Globe, the Washington Post, the Los Angeles Times and the San Francisco Chronicle. She teaches in the low residence MFA program in nonfiction narrative at the University of Georgia.
Jennifer Bowen is the author of THE BOOK OF KIN, which is a finalist for the 2026 MN Book Awards. Her work has won a Pushcart Prize, a Tim McGinnis Award, and more. Her prose can be found in The Sun, Orion, The Iowa Review, The Kenyon Review and elsewhere. Jen is the founding director of the Minnesota Prison Writing Workshop, mom of resilient sons, and proud resident of St. Paul's Midway neighborhood.
